You have the M59 Yugo SKS variant. The M56/66A1 was the first variant to have the muzzle brake and grenade launcher. Your Yugo SKS was one of the first ones made. It was not sporterized. The M59's are worth more because they have lower production numbersHere is my Bubba Yugo...........Minus the GL and the GL ladder Site . ( Also lost the bayonet locking collar .
